What does a power systems engineer do in a part-time role?

A Power Systems Engineer working part-time is responsible for analyzing, designing, and maintaining electrical power systems such as generation, transmission, and distribution networks. Their work may include performing load flow studies, evaluating system reliability, and supporting grid integration of renewable energy sources, all within a reduced hour schedule. Part-time engineers often focus on specific projects, consulting tasks, or technical support, depending on their employer’s needs. This role requires strong analytical skills and knowledge of industry standards, and may also involve using specialized software for system modeling and simulation.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a power systems engineer part time,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Power Systems Engineer Part Time, you need a solid background in electrical engineering, power systems analysis, and a relevant engineering degree. Familiarity with power system simulation tools (such as ETAP, PSS/E, or PSCAD) and knowledge of industry standards and certifications like a Professional Engineer (PE) license are highly valuable. Strong problem-solving skills, effective communication, and the ability to work independently are standout soft skills for this role. These skills and qualifications are crucial for ensuring reliable power system design, analysis, and collaboration in dynamic or project-based environments.

Your Opportunity
As a Civil Engineer in Training in our Community Development Group, you will have the opportunity to work on a wide variety of innovative and diverse land development projects. This position involves working collaboratively with design teams in the development of construction plans and specifications; preparing reports, studies, and construction contract documents; computing quantities and preparing cost estimates; performing field observations and assisting in the coordination and management of construction activities.
Your Key Responsibilities
  • Perform civil design and technical tasks on projects under the supervision of the Project Manager or Project Engineer.
  • Work with other engineering disciplines and professionals in the coordination of the project.
  • Perform data analysis and calculations to analyze and design civil system components.
  • Collect data and gathering information to support design decisions.
  • Perform field work/construction observation under the supervision of a senior engineer/designer and/or construction manager.
  • Interpret and verify compliance with applicable codes and engineering standards and practices.
  • Analyze proposed project solutions to ensure reliability, resource efficiency and cost effectiveness.
  • Communicate professionally and effectively, both verbally and written, with project team members, clients, and contractors.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Your Capabilities and Credentials
  • Strong foundational understanding of general concepts of civil engineering design.
  • Ability to participate and collaborate in a project team setting and to engage in creative and critical thought.
  • Ability to interpret sketches, drawings, building programs and other similar materials.
  • Good communication skills, attentiveness to detail, and multi-tasking ability.
  • Willingness to learn new skills and interface with multiple project managers.
  • Proficient with MS Office Suite including Word, Excel, OneNote, and OneDrive.
  • Proficient with AutoCAD and Civil3D.
  • Possess a valid driver's license with a good driving record.

Education and Experience
  • Bachelor's degree in Civil Engineering or an equivalent combination of education and related experience.
  • Minimum of 1 year of related professional work or Co-op/Internship experience preferred.
  • Engineer-in-Training designation, successful completion of the EIT exam or the ability to take the EIT exam within six months of starting preferred.
